1. Identification

Accurate identification of the rodent species infesting an attic is paramount to formulating an effective eradication strategy. Distinct species exhibit varying behaviors and preferences, influencing the success of targeted control measures.

  • Species Determination

    Differentiating between common attic inhabitants, such as the Norway rat (Rattus norvegicus) and the roof rat (Rattus rattus), necessitates careful observation. Dropping characteristics, nesting habits, and damage patterns offer clues. Misidentification can lead to the use of ineffective trapping methods or inappropriate bait selection, prolonging the infestation. For example, roof rats are more arboreal than Norway rats, favoring elevated pathways and requiring trap placement in attic rafters. Norway rats are more likely to be found at ground level, near the attic access points.

  • Activity Level Assessment

    Determining the scale of the infestation impacts the scope and intensity of the eradication efforts. The presence of numerous droppings, gnawing marks, and distinct urine odors indicates a significant population. Audio cues, such as scratching or scurrying sounds, provide further insights into rodent activity. A light infestation may be addressable through a limited trapping program, whereas a heavy infestation warrants a more aggressive, multi-pronged approach, potentially involving professional pest control services.

  • Entry Point Detection

    Identifying access points used by rodents facilitates targeted sealing efforts, preventing future infestations. Common entry points include gaps around pipes, vents, and loose-fitting roof tiles. Visual inspection, combined with the use of tracking powder, can reveal pathways. Sealing all identified entry points is essential for long-term rodent control, even after the existing population has been eliminated. Failure to address entry points renders eradication efforts temporary.

  • Damage Assessment

    Evaluating the extent of damage caused by rodents assists in prioritizing repair efforts and mitigating potential hazards. Gnawed electrical wiring poses a fire risk, while damaged insulation reduces energy efficiency. Urine and fecal contamination can create unsanitary conditions, requiring specialized cleaning and disinfection. Thorough damage assessment informs resource allocation and ensures that all affected areas are properly addressed following rodent removal.

2. Sealing Entry Points

The effectiveness of rodent eradication within an attic is directly contingent upon the meticulous sealing of all potential entry points. Without addressing these vulnerabilities, any attempt to eliminate existing infestations proves to be a temporary measure, ultimately leading to recurrent problems. Rodents can exploit surprisingly small openings; a gap as small as a quarter of an inch is sufficient for a young rat to gain access. Common entry points include cracks in the foundation, gaps around pipes and wiring, vents lacking proper screens, and deteriorated roof flashing. Failure to seal these access points allows new rodents to quickly replace those that have been trapped or poisoned, rendering previous efforts futile. The correlation demonstrates a cause-and-effect relationship: unsealed entry points cause recurring infestations, while effective sealing contributes significantly to long-term rodent control.

Effective sealing requires a comprehensive inspection of the entire attic and its surrounding structure, both inside and outside. This inspection should identify all potential entry points, no matter how small. Materials such as steel wool, expanding foam, metal flashing, and cement can be used to seal these openings effectively. Steel wool, when packed tightly into gaps, deters rodents due to its unpalatable texture. Expanding foam fills larger voids, while metal flashing provides a durable barrier against gnawing. Cement effectively seals cracks in concrete foundations. Careful selection and application of appropriate sealing materials are essential for a successful outcome. 4. Baiting Strategies

Effective rodent eradication within attic spaces frequently necessitates the deployment of baiting strategies. The strategic use of rodenticides serves as a mechanism for population control, particularly when combined with other methods such as trapping and exclusion. Baiting aims to deliver lethal doses of poison to rodents, reducing their numbers and mitigating the damage they inflict.

  • Rodenticide Selection

    The choice of rodenticide is critical, requiring consideration of factors such as target species, safety concerns, and regulatory restrictions. Anticoagulant rodenticides, which interfere with blood clotting, are commonly used. However, concerns exist regarding secondary poisoning of predators that consume poisoned rodents. Non-anticoagulant rodenticides offer alternative mechanisms of action but may pose different risks. Selection must adhere to product labels and comply with local and national regulations. Example: Selecting a bait formulation containing bromethalin instead of warfarin in areas where warfarin resistance is documented.

  • Bait Placement and Containment

    Strategic placement of bait stations is essential for maximizing efficacy and minimizing non-target exposure. Bait stations should be located in areas of high rodent activity, such as along runways and near nesting sites. The stations must be tamper-resistant to prevent access by children, pets, and wildlife. Proper containment minimizes the risk of accidental ingestion. Example: Placing bait stations inside sealed containers within the attic to prevent access by squirrels or birds that may inadvertently enter through existing openings.

  • Bait Rotation and Monitoring

    Rodents can develop bait aversion or resistance over time, necessitating the periodic rotation of bait formulations. Monitoring bait consumption provides insights into the effectiveness of the baiting program and allows for adjustments to placement or bait type. Regular inspection and replenishment of bait stations are critical. Example: Switching from a grain-based bait to a block bait if consumption of the grain-based bait declines significantly, suggesting aversion or a change in rodent feeding preferences.

  • Safety Precautions and Disposal

    Handling rodenticides requires strict adherence to safety precautions to protect human health and the environment. Personal protective equipment, such as gloves and masks, should be worn during bait handling. Proper disposal of unused bait and dead rodents is essential to prevent secondary poisoning and environmental contamination. Adhering to label instructions and local regulations is paramount. Example: Wearing gloves when handling rodenticide blocks and double-bagging dead rodents before disposal in a designated waste container to prevent scavenging by pets or wildlife.

7. Preventative Measures

The implementation of preventative measures is inextricably linked to long-term rodent control within attic environments. Addressing the conditions that attract and sustain rodent populations is as important as eliminating existing infestations. A proactive approach to rodent management significantly reduces the likelihood of future problems, minimizing the need for reactive measures. The absence of preventative strategies guarantees a cyclical pattern of infestation and eradication. Examples of preventative measures include regularly inspecting and sealing potential entry points, maintaining proper sanitation practices, and trimming vegetation that provides access to the roof. Without these steps, even a successfully eradicated population can quickly re-establish itself.

Specific preventative actions can be implemented based on the characteristics of the attic and its surrounding environment. Installing wire mesh over vents and other openings prevents rodent access without impeding airflow. Storing food items in sealed containers within the attic, if applicable, eliminates potential food sources. Regularly removing debris and clutter reduces nesting opportunities. Trimming tree branches that overhang the roof limits the ability of rodents to access the attic via aerial routes. These actions collectively create an environment that is less hospitable to rodents, discouraging their presence. Regular inspections, at least twice a year, can identify vulnerabilities before they lead to infestations. Frequently Asked Questions

The following questions and answers address common concerns regarding rodent infestations in attics, providing clarity on effective management strategies and potential challenges.

Question 1: What are the initial signs of a rodent infestation in an attic?

Early indicators include scratching or scurrying sounds, especially at night; the presence of rodent droppings; gnaw marks on wood or wiring; and a musty odor emanating from the attic space.

Question 2: Is it necessary to clean the attic after removing a rodent infestation?

Yes, cleaning and disinfecting the attic are essential. Rodent droppings and urine can harbor harmful pathogens, posing health risks. Contaminated insulation should be removed and replaced.

Question 3: What types of materials are most effective for sealing rodent entry points?

Steel wool, expanding foam, metal flashing, and cement are all suitable for sealing entry points. The choice of material depends on the size and nature of the opening.

Question 4: How often should attic spaces be inspected for potential rodent activity?

Attic spaces should be inspected at least twice per year, preferably in the spring and fall, to identify potential entry points and signs of rodent activity before a full-blown infestation develops.

Question 5: What are the potential dangers associated with using rodenticides in an attic?

Rodenticides pose risks to non-target species, including pets and wildlife, through accidental ingestion or secondary poisoning. Proper placement and containment of bait stations are critical to minimize these risks.

Question 6: When is it advisable to seek professional assistance for rodent control in an attic?

Professional assistance is recommended for large or persistent infestations, when there are concerns about safety or the environment, or when DIY methods prove ineffective. Professionals possess the expertise and resources to address complex rodent problems safely and efficiently.
